METHOD FOR CONTROLLING SODIUM-SULFUR BATTERY

A method for controlling a plurality of sodium-sulfur batteries that, in an interconnected system in which a power generation device that fluctuates in output and an electric power storage-compensation device are combined to supply power to an electric power system, are each included in the electric power storage-compensation device and compensate for output fluctuations of the power generation device, is provided. When one sodium-sulfur battery of the plurality of sodium-sulfur batteries reaches a discharge end, the sodium-sulfur battery reaching the discharge end is charged from a sodium-sulfur battery other than the sodium-sulfur battery reaching the discharge end. When one sodium-sulfur battery of the plurality of sodium-sulfur batteries reaches a charge end, the sodium-sulfur battery reaching the charge end is discharged to charge a sodium-sulfur battery other than the sodium-sulfur battery reaching the charge end. Thus, control is performed so that all of the plurality of sodium-sulfur batteries are in a state of not reaching any of the charge end and the discharge end. This sodium-sulfur battery control method enables fluctuations of natural energy to be compensated over a wide range.
